1.
WHAT _MXL _CAPSULES ARE AND WHAT THEY ARE USED FOR
These capsules have been prescribed for you by your doctor to relieve
severe pain over a period of 24 hours.
They contain the active ingredient morphine which belongs to a group
of medicines called strong analgesics
or ‘painkillers’.

WHAT YOU NEED TO KNOW BEFORE YOU TAKE _MXL_ CAPSULES
DO NOT TAKE _MXL _CAPSULES IF:
•
you are allergic to morphine or any of the other ingredients of the
capsules (see section 6);
•
you have breathing problems, such as obstructive airways disease,
respiratory depression, or severe
asthma. Your doctor will have told you if you have these conditions.
Symptoms may include
breathlessness, coughing or breathing more slowly or weakly than
expected;
•
you have a head injury that causes a severe headache or makes you feel
sick. This is because the
capsules may make these symptoms worse or hide the extent of the head
injury;

1. Name of the medicinal product
MXL 30 mg 60 mg, 90 mg, 120 mg, 150 mg, 200 mg prolonged release
capsules
2. Qualitative and quantitative composition
Each 30 mg prolonged-release capsule contains Morphine Sulfate 30 mg.
Each 60 mg prolonged-release capsule contains Morphine Sulfate 60 mg
Each 90 mg prolonged-release capsule contains Morphine Sulfate 90 mg
Each 120 mg prolonged-release capsule contains Morphine Sulfate 120 mg
Each 150 mg prolonged-release capsule contains Morphine Sulfate 150 mg
Each 200 mg prolonged-release capsule contains Morphine Sulfate 200 mg
